chartbrew
Dashboards & VisualizationOpen-source reporting platform to build and share live dashboards from APIs, SQL and NoSQL databases, with powerful AI assistant, scheduling, and embeddable charts
Features
- Connects directly to databases and APIs to generate charts
- Provides a chart builder, editable dashboards, and embeddable charts
- Includes query & request editor with team collaboration features
Recent releases
View all 11 releases →
v5.0.1
Breaking risk
Security fixes
- Replaced innerHTML with safer DOM rendering in tooltips
Notable features
- Expanded table view with maximize option
- Server-side filtering from dashboards and datasets
- Filter-aware Redis caching
Full changelog
Changelog
✨ New features
- Added a larger expanded table view, with an option to maximise the table for easier data inspection.
- Introduced server runtime filtering to consolidate filters applied from both dashboards and datasets.
- Introduced a new filter-aware caching strategy with Redis for sources and charts.
🚀 Feature improvements
- Replaced color pickers with the HeroUI component.
- Improved dashboard filter UI and date picker behavior.
- Switched to chart skeletons while initial filtering is loading for smoother UX.
- Improved collection popup behavior.
- Improved contrast by darkening the default light color on secondary surfaces.
- Added a caching guide and updated the filtering guide for agents
🐛 Bug fixes
- Fixed an issue where refreshing charts in public reports would not update chart data.
- Fixed bar chart import issues.
- Fixed labels when bar charts include KPIs.
- Fixed bottom padding for charts that include KPIs.
- Fixed visual issues in dataset completion modals.
- Fixed the tutorials link in the connection wizard.
- Fixed sharing drawer placement.
- Applied small UI fixes across the app.
🔒 Security
- Replaced
innerHTMLusage in chart tooltips with safer DOM node rendering usingtextContent.
⬆️ Other changes
- Removed CircleCI configuration.
v5.0.0
New feature
Security fixes
- Invite token validation for /invited route
- Access-control refinements for project admins with tagged datasets
- Report access hardening to prevent unauthorized project access by guessing report names
Notable features
- Complete UI overhaul migrating from HeroUI v2 to HeroUI v3 across all components
- Monaco code editor replacing Ace editor for SQL, API, Mongo, ClickHouse, Firestore and other query builders
- React Email templates for chart alerts, dashboard snapshots, and password resets
v4.9.0
Security relevant
Security fixes
- Fixed important security vulnerabilities (see public advisories)
Notable features
- Audit logging for data requests and workers
- Improved job queue locks
Weekly OSS security release digest.
The CVE patches and breaking changes that affected production tools this week. One email, every Sunday.
No spam, unsubscribe anytime.
About
Stars
3,942
Forks
442
Languages
JavaScript
EJS
TypeScript
Install & Platforms
Install via
docker
npm